I've heard rumors that a guy who lives in my town played a zombie in Day of the Dead. He's a former film critic from my local newspaper named Tom Brown. He is also a filmmaker of sorts who made a movie about bullying that I watched at school while in 5th grade. I see him out every now & then. He's usually at FYE trading in DVDs. If I were someone who just approached people, I'd ask him straight up sometime. Anyway, there's an uncredited zombie in Steel's death that sort of looks like him...as shown on this site that rogueslayer shared with us: members.tripod.com/drlogan/unzombies.htmI may jump in & take a screen capture since this picture is really small.
